Pew Research 2026 Political Typology Survey

The Pew Research Center released their own Political Typology Survey updated for the 2026 calendar year, and it takes a simplistic and straightforward “Left-vs-Right” approach to the political spectrum. This 24-question survey is surprisingly quick and centers politics with relation to the United States. The base of the survey and their nine different classifications of political alignment formed from a national survey of 10,000 U.S. adults, and may be help introduce the participant to a more modern labels for classic political concepts.


FindMyPolitics Political Compass Test

My preferred and recommended test in this arena comes from the website FindMyPolitics with a more in-depth and configurable survey where you can choose how deep you wish to go on a US-political or globally-political scale. Each version has three different lengths of test questions: 30, 50, and 80. I chose to go the most in-depth with 80 questions with the Global Political Compass test version. I prefer this test because not only does it include a useful analysis page of results to break down each of the five concentrations involved in determining alignment, but the results graph your political alignment in relation to other notable political figures and nations through history’s past and present. The graph is two-dimensional with alignment on the horizontal access representing left or right alignment on economic policy and the vertical access representing social policy (Libertarian to Authoritarian).

What You Can Do

1. Call Your Senators!

Find the phone number for your senators through the Senate's website and call them, or call the US Capitol switchboard at 202-224-3121. Add these phone numbers as contacts in your smartphone so you can call in the future, too.

Every state has two US Senators. Call both of them! If you have trouble getting through to their office in Washington, D.C., go to each senator's senate.gov page and call one of their branch offices local to your state. Those state branch offices are usually easier to get through to a real person.
